Abraham: The Call and the Covenant / Genesis 1–22: Course 3

Genesis is an ancient book. But it speaks to some of the deepest questions we face today. Genesis reveals that there is a God who created our beautiful world. And He gave people a noble calling. It explains that our world has been fractured by human rebellion against God. It also presents the beginnings of His plan to fix what was broken. God has lovingly created each of us to join in this plan to restore His beautiful world, and we will find our deepest fulfillment by partaking in His great story.

This is the third course of a four-course series exploring the first part of the book of Genesis.
